I am going upgrade as my current PC as it is getting old. My current PC has an ATI 9700pro AGP card. My new system will have PCI-e. I dont want to waste alot of £££ on a graphic card until the R600 comes out. Could you tell what current ATI PCI-e card is equivalent to the 9700pro.

I'd recommend one of the X800's (vanilla, XL, GT) or X1600XT. An X700 pro might be decent too but it wasn't too popular and I can't remember how it did. Anything else is either too slow or too expensive to match your criteria. Don't touch anything in the X300 or X1300 range.
